Narrative

Employee was leaving the premises at the end of his shift. He pulled on the chain used to lock the front yard gate. He heard and felt a ""pop"" in right arm. He pulled his tendon off of his right bicep. Please note that the date of this injury was also his last day of employment. He had previously given us his notice that he would be seeking employment elsewhere.
